Table of Contents
Implementing effective schema markup strategies is essential for online course platforms aiming to improve their search engine visibility and attract more students. Schema markup helps search engines understand the content of your pages better, which can lead to enhanced rich snippets and higher click-through rates.
Understanding Schema Markup for Online Courses
Schema markup is a type of structured data that you add to your website's HTML to provide additional context to search engines. For online course platforms, this means clearly defining course details, instructor information, reviews, and other relevant data.
Key Schema Types for Online Course Platforms
- Course: Describes the course title, description, provider, and other specifics.
- Person: Details about instructors or course creators.
- Review: Student reviews and ratings.
- Offer: Pricing, discounts, and availability.
- VideoObject: Embedded videos or promotional content.
Implementing Schema Markup Effectively
To maximize the benefits of schema markup, ensure that your data is accurate, complete, and up-to-date. Use JSON-LD format for implementation, as it is recommended by Google for its ease of use and compatibility.
Best Practices for Schema Markup Integration
- Validate your schema markup with tools like Google's Rich Results Test.
- Keep your data consistent across all platforms.
- Use unique identifiers for courses to avoid duplication.
- Regularly update your schema data to reflect changes in course offerings.
Common Mistakes to Avoid
- Using outdated or incorrect schema types.
- Failing to validate schema markup before publishing.
- Overloading pages with irrelevant schema data.
- Neglecting to update schema information after course modifications.
Tools and Resources
- Google's Rich Results Test
- Schema.org official documentation
- JSON-LD generators and validators
- SEO plugins with schema markup features (e.g., Yoast SEO, Rank Math)
By strategically implementing schema markup, online course platforms can enhance their search presence, attract more learners, and provide a richer user experience. Consistent updates and validation are key to maintaining effective schema strategies.